Abstract
Pure and CuCl2 Poly(methyl methacrylate) (PMMA) films have been prepared by the solution cast method.The morphology of the films was investigated by atomic force microscopy (AFM).The roughness, grain size, and average diameter of the pure and doped samples vary between an increase and a decrease with an increase the doping concentration.The root mean square (RMS) roughness of the dope of copper nanoparticle CuCl2 on the PMMA polymer was studied from 3D AFM images,increases from (5.27) nm to (10.42) nm.The homogeneity of the surface grains rises with the inuction in the value of the roughness rate with an increase in the dope.The optical characteristics of the polymer films were analyzed in the (200-1200) nm wavelength range.The transmittance, absorption coefficient, band gap, and Urbach have been estimated.The value of the energy band gap was 3.72 eV for an an undoped sample and it has been decreased to be (3.3,3.23, and 3.19) eV for (1%, 2% and 3%) of the doping ratio of CuCl2 while Urbach energy was increased after dopping.
